Ok, I built my current set up not too long ago, had it dyno'd and wasnt too happy with the numbers, I'm looking for more power. My current 2v put down 275rwhp and 267rwtq which at the track has a current best of 13.1@107mph w/ a 2.1 60ft, which tells me with a better launch is good enough for mid 12s.

Here's the thing, I'm tearing this motor out and have the option of getting a 5.4 short block for 350$. I was considering building that and putting a lightning blower on it w/ my current PI heads. Other option is I have some 4v 93 lincoln mark 8 heads laying around that I could use on the 5.4 then spray it, but to my knowledge I wouldn't have a intake to match. Or keep the 4.6 and build it for forced induction???

Im torn in too many different directions, I really need some help in deciding what to do.
